#e3949d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3949d is composed of 89% red, 58%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.8% magenta, 30.8%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 353.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 73.5%. #e3949d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c7293b.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#e3949d color description : Very soft red.
#e3949d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3949d has RGB values of R:227, G:148,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.31,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14914717.

Shades and Tints of #e3949d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fbf1f2 is the lightest one.
